This art piece embraces the chilly essence of a Canadian winter while infusing it with emotional depth and a surreal, dream-like quality that transports viewers to a transcendent place beyond the ordinary. *** About Aspen Valley Wildlife Sanctuary: Aspen Valley Wildlife Sanctuary is dedicated to the rescue and rehabilitation of wildlife in the Muskoka region of Ontario, Canada. With a variety of habitats spread over several hundred acres, it provides a safe haven for a wide spectrum of native species, nurturing them back to health with the goal of eventual re-release into their natural environments. The sanctuary's commitment to conservation and education offers a valuable resource for both wildlife and the community, promoting a greater understanding of the interdependence of humans and nature.
